The Role

As Restaurant Manager, you’ll take full responsibility for the day-to-day operation of our restaurant and bar / café areas, ensuring outstanding service, strong financial performance and a consistently high guest experience.

You’ll lead and develop your team on the floor, work closely with senior leaders and chefs, and ensure service delivery aligns with Champneys’ wellbeing ethos, dietary standards and luxury brand expectations.

  • What You’ll Be Doing
  • Leading the restaurant operation and setting service standards
  • Managing, motivating and developing your team through effective leadership
  • Ensuring every service runs smoothly, professionally and on brand
  • Building positive relationships with guests and resolving feedback confidently
  • Overseeing rotas, staffing levels and payroll spend within budget
  • Managing stock, suppliers and equipment to agreed standards
  • Driving strong financial performance and continuous improvement
  • Ensuring full compliance with food safety, health & safety and company policies
  • Acting as Duty Manager on a rota basis and supporting wider resort operations
  • Working collaboratively with Chefs, Front of House and senior leaders

How to prepare for a job interview at Champneys

Show Your People Skills

In hospitality, customer service is everything! Be ready to showcase examples of how you've engaged with customers positively. Maybe you turned a tough situation around or went that extra mile for a guest—let’s hear those stories!

Know Your Menu Inside Out

Expect some technical questions about food and drink, especially if you're applying for a kitchen or service role. Brush up on the menu items, including ingredients and any potential allergens. If you’ve got any favourite dishes or cocktails, have a little something prepared to discuss, too!

Demonstrate Your Team Spirit

Hospitality thrives on teamwork, so think of examples where you've worked well with others in a fast-paced environment. Be prepared to discuss what makes a great team member and how you contribute to a positive working vibe. They’re looking for that 'good fit!'

Get Ready for a Practical Test

In full-time food service roles, don’t be surprised if they want to see your skills in action. Whether it's serving a table or prepping a dish, be mentally prepared for a practical test during the interview. Practice makes perfect—a little dry run with friends could give you the edge!
